Dundee Vegan Festival 2026

The Dundee Vegan Festival stands as a premier celebration of ethical living, plant-based innovation, and sustainable lifestyle practices in Scotland. Hosted at the historic Bonar Hall, this vibrant one-day gathering brings together local and international vendors, passionate activists, culinary artisans, and curious visitors. Whether you are a dedicated lifelong vegan or simply eager to explore a healthier, more eco-conscious lifestyle, the Dundee Vegan Festival offers an enriching environment designed to educate, inspire, and delight audiences of all ages. Culinary Excellence and Street Food Market At the heart of the event is an expansive exhibition hall packed with over 60 specialist stalls. Visitors can embark on a rich culinary journey featuring global plant-based street food caterers. From indulgent artisan cheeses, gourmet burgers, and wood-fired pizzas to authentic international dishes, decadent pastries, and wholesome raw desserts, every food lover will find something extraordinary. The festival showcases cutting-edge plant-based alternatives that match traditional cuisine in both flavor and texture, proving that ethical eating requires no compromise on taste. Ethical Shopping and Eco-Friendly Goods Beyond the delicious food options, the Dundee Vegan Festival serves as a massive marketplace for conscious consumerism. Attendees can discover an impressive collection of cruelty-free skincare products, organic cosmetics, hand-poured soy candles, non-leather footwear, and ethically produced apparel. Independent retailers and charity organizations gather to showcase products made without animal exploitation or unnecessary environmental damage. Shopping directly from small businesses allows attendees to support passionate entrepreneurs who actively contribute to a greener future. Educational Talks, Demos, and Wellness Sessions Education and empowerment are central to the festival's mission. Throughout the day, a curated schedule of expert speakers, nutritionists, and chefs take the stage to share actionable insights on plant-based nutrition, sustainable living, animal welfare, and eco-conscious daily practices. Live cooking demonstrations offer practical recipes that can be easily recreated at home. Additionally, the festival emphasizes holistic health with interactive wellness sessions—such as guided sound baths and mindfulness talks—providing a refreshing space for self-care and mental well-being. Community, Connection, and Inclusivity More than just a market, the Dundee Vegan Festival is a supportive community Hub. It provides a welcoming environment where attendees can connect with like-minded individuals, share personal experiences, and ask questions without judgment. With accessible facilities, affordable ticket options, fast-track VIP packages, and free entry for children under 16, the festival ensures an inclusive day out for families, friends, and solo explorers alike. Mark your calendar for this essential Scottish event and take part in a movement driving positive change for animals, personal health, and the planet.

Floss and Rock Autumn Toy and Gift Showcase 2026

The Floss & Rock Autumn Toy & Gift Showcase 2026 stands as a premier gathering for retail professionals, wholesale distributors, and eco-conscious brand managers across the global toy and gift sectors. Held in the iconic coastal town of Blackpool, England—the birthplace and proud headquarters of Floss & Rock—this three-day trade exhibition highlights the very best in traditional, plastic-free, and imaginative play. Attendees will experience firsthand how thoughtful craftsmanship, vibrant modern illustrations, and strict environmental standards can harmonize to create world-class children's products. Unveiling the Autumn/Winter Product Collections At the center of this showcase is the grand debut of Floss & Rock's newest seasonal line-up. Built around screen-free play values for children aged two to ten, the upcoming collections focus on tactile engagement and creative development. Visitors will explore interactive display booths showcasing magnetic dress-up sets, color-changing magic water cards, reusable play boxes, jigsaw puzzles, and eco-friendly umbrellas. Every item on display reflects the brand's firm dedication to eliminating single-use plastics and utilizing responsibly sourced materials, offering retail buyers high-margin inventory that resonates with modern, environmentally conscious parents. Sustainable Innovation and Industry Leadership As a recipient of the prestigious King's Award for Enterprise for International Trade, Floss & Rock brings significant industry leadership to the stage. Throughout the event, founders Tim and Gill, alongside senior product designers, will lead targeted discussions examining the future of eco-friendly toy production. These sessions will delve into the logistical and material advancements required to produce safe, non-toxic, and durable toys that meet demanding international quality criteria. Attendees will gain actionable insights into supply chain transparency, sustainable packaging alternatives, and strategies for navigating evolving global trade regulations in the children's retail marketplace. Interactive Workshops and Hands-On Demonstrations Beyond passive viewing, the showcase incorporates dynamic, hands-on workshops designed to give attendees a clear understanding of product functionality and retail merchandising potential. Live product testing zones allow retail buyers to directly experience the durability, artistic appeal, and play value of the latest crafts, games, and stationery items. In addition, specialized merchandising seminars will offer practical advice on window display arrangements, point-of-sale setups, and digital marketing strategies tailored specifically to boutique gift stores and independent toy retailers seeking to boost store footfall. B2B Networking and Global Partnership Opportunities Networking remains a core pillar of the Blackpool showcase. Designed to foster long-term business partnerships, the event provides dedicated buyer lounges and pre-scheduled B2B meeting spaces where international distributors, boutique shop owners, and high-street purchasing agents can connect directly with the Floss & Rock team. Whether seeking exclusive regional distribution rights, exploring private bulk orders, or simply refreshing store inventory ahead of the peak holiday retail season, attendees will find an open, collaborative atmosphere tailored to business growth. Join Us in the Heart of Blackpool Set against the historic backdrop of Blackpool's Winter Gardens, this event perfectly blends professional commercial opportunities with the unique seaside heritage that inspired the Floss & Rock brand name. Retail leaders and industry innovators are invited to register early to secure access to exclusive trade pricing, complimentary product samples, and direct entry into all keynote panels and creative workshops. Elevate your product offerings, embrace sustainable retail trends, and experience the warmth and creativity of Floss & Rock this August in Blackpool.

South Tees Health Innovation and Research Summit

The South Tees Health Innovation & Research Summit is a flagship event hosted at The James Cook University Hospital, designed to bridge the gap between frontline clinical practice and cutting-edge medical research. As a major tertiary center and one of the largest hospitals in the UK, James Cook University Hospital serves as the perfect backdrop for a day dedicated to the evolution of patient care through technology and evidence-based medicine. This summit brings together the brightest minds in the North East's medical community to discuss the future of the NHS and the specific healthcare challenges facing the Middlesbrough and Teesside regions. The 2026 summit focuses heavily on "The Digital Clinician," exploring how artificial intelligence and machine learning are being integrated into daily hospital workflows. Attendees will have the opportunity to hear from keynote speakers who are pioneers in robotic surgery and genomic medicine. The event is structured to encourage cross-disciplinary dialogue, allowing surgeons, nurses, data scientists, and administrative leaders to collaborate on solutions for improving patient outcomes and streamlining hospital efficiency. Beyond the formal presentations, the Academic Centre will host a series of breakout rooms where ongoing clinical trials at the hospital will be showcased, providing a transparent look at the life-saving work happening within the trust. A significant portion of the afternoon is dedicated to the "Patient Voice" initiative. This segment highlights how research and innovation directly impact the lives of people in Middlesbrough. Local patients who have participated in clinical trials at James Cook will share their journeys, providing a grounded, human perspective to the data-heavy scientific discussions. This ensures that while we talk about high-tech solutions, the core mission—compassionate care—remains at the heart of the conversation. The summit also serves as a vital networking hub for the region's burgeoning life sciences sector. By fostering partnerships between the NHS and private industry, the event aims to accelerate the adoption of new medical devices and digital health tools. For those looking to enter the field or advance their careers, the summit provides unparalleled access to senior consultants and research leads. Whether you are interested in the latest developments in cardiology, neurosciences, or oncology—all areas where James Cook University Hospital excels—this summit offers a comprehensive look at the state of modern healthcare. It is more than just a meeting; it is a catalyst for change in the South Tees community.
